Tungsten carbide is one of the most common materials used in CNC cutting tools. It is a very hard and versatile material that is used to make a variety of cutting tools, including router bits, milling cutters, drills, reamers, and taps. Tungsten carbide is often used for high-precision and high-speed operations, as it is extremely resistant to wear and tear. It is also very resistant to high temperatures and can withstand high cutting speeds. Additionally, tungsten carbide has excellent cutting properties, allowing for high accuracy and repeatability.

Materials

 

The selection of thread cutting insert materials varies depending on the workpiece material to achieve better cutting performance.

Some optional Carbide Grade:

Metal Grade performance and use
MC1 MC1 exhibits exceptional matrix red hardness and remarkable toughness, making it ideally suited for processing with high-efficiency threading machines. Furthermore, it is perfectly compatible with the threading requirements of oil pipes, casings, and couplings that belong to medium steel grades and secondary high steel grades, encompassing materials like J55, K55, N80, L80.
MC2 MC2 boasts high matrix strength, excellent red hardness, and good impact resistance. It is suitable for high-efficiency threading machine processing of medium to high steel grade oil pipes, casings, and coupling threads, such as N80 and P110.
MC3 MC3 boasts good overall mechanical properties in its matrix, along with stable cutting performance. It is suitable for high-efficiency threading machine processing of oil pipes, casings, and coupling threads that belong to low, medium, and secondary high steel grades, such as H40, J55, M65, C75, N80, and similar specifications.
P35 P35 utilizes a matrix with high strength and excellent red hardness, making it suitable for processing the threads of drill pipes, oil drilling collars, sucker rods, and other related equipment.
YT15 Depending on the specific application, it can be coated or uncoated, and possesses good red hardness and toughness. It is suitable for use in the manufacturing of specialized chip breakers for thread cutting combs and other cutting tools.
S Material

Exhibits excellent wear resistance and high-temperature red hardness, making it suitable for the internal threading of medium to high alloy steels.

 

 

Catogories of Products

 

  1. Turning Inserts: Turning inserts are designed for use in turning operations on a CNC machine. These inserts typically have four cutting edges and are used to create smooth, high-quality finishes.
  2. Milling Inserts: Milling inserts are designed for use in CNC milling machines. They are usually made from carbide and feature multiple cutting edges, allowing for the production of complex shapes and surfaces.
  3. Drilling Inserts: Drilling inserts are designed for use in CNC drilling operations. These inserts are typically made from carbide and are used to create precise holes in a variety of materials.
  4. Reaming Inserts: Reaming inserts are designed to be used in CNC reaming operations. These inserts typically have multiple cutting edges and are used to create high-precision holes in a variety of materials.
  5. Boring Inserts: Boring inserts are designed for use in CNC boring operations. These inserts typically have multiple cutting edges and are used to create high-precision holes in a variety of materials.
